German FAZ: VW profit breaks by 41 percent in the first quarter

After the weak last year, Volkswagen also started in 2025 with a drop in profits. The bottom line was that the profit from Europe’s largest car manufacturer decreased by almost 41 percent in the first quarter to 2.19 billion euros, as the company in Wolfsburg announced.
